The 'Haha, Yes' Hedgehog: A Cultural Relic

The hedgehog meme, with its origins in a 2010s YouTube video, has become an iconic symbol for Tesla owners. It's a playful way to acknowledge a significant purchase, and it sets the tone for the brand's lighthearted and internet-savvy image. What makes this meme fascinating is how it encapsulates the company's ability to embrace internet culture and connect with younger generations.

Tesla's Whimsical Touches

Tesla's love for pop culture references goes beyond the hedgehog. From acceleration modes named after 'Spaceballs' to Easter eggs like a sketchpad, the company infuses its vehicles with a sense of fun. This strategy is a brilliant way to differentiate itself from traditional automakers and create a community-like feel. Tesla's Robotaxi Pricing Strategy

Tesla's Robotaxi service in Austin has seen a recent price hike, particularly affecting short trips. This move is intriguing, as it suggests a shift in strategy and a response to operational challenges.

Pricing Adjustments and Implications

The increase in the base fare while keeping the per-mile rate steady indicates a focus on sustainability and managing demand. Tesla is likely addressing high wait times and operational constraints by discouraging very short trips. This strategic adjustment is a reminder that Tesla is not just about disruptive technology but also about building a sustainable business model.
